Colt Under the Wire


Book Description

The loving friendship of a girl and her colt is severely tested as they endure the threat of being separated due to his coltish antics, that threaten not only his own safety, but that of others. Though this story was written for boys and girls age 8 to 12 this story is loved by children from 8 to 98 that enjoy a warm fuzzy story with many quick turns.

Down to the Wire


Book Description

I'm Not Evil is the fastest horse that Marvin and his dad, Nick, have ever seen. When Evil is on the track, it seems like he could run all day. The black colt is just as big as he is fast. Evil's desire to run burns so strongly-no rider on his back or bit in his mouth can ever tame it. Can Evil win the Triple Crown and other big races? Will any other horse ever catch him?
